How many rooms should a housekeeper clean in 8 hours?
On average, housekeepers clean 13 to 15 rooms a day, but it can be as high as 30 at some hotels. And they’re expected to clean them all in one eight-hour shift. So, even if you do put your “Do Not Disturb” sign out, sometimes they still have to knock.

How often should hotel rooms be deep cleaned?
Deep cleaning is the process of taking a room out of a hotel’s salable inventory and thoroughly cleaning it to more exacting standards than is normally performed during the daily housekeeping maintenance. Most guestrooms are deep-cleaned between two and four times a year depending on the occupancy level of the hotel.

What is cleaning frequency schedule?
Frequency schedule: a schedule that indicated how often each item on an areainventory list needs to be cleaned or maintained. Items that must be cleaned on adaily or weekly basis become part of a routing cleaning cycle and are incorporatedinto standard work procedures.
What should be on a cleaning schedule?
A schedule must be drawn up and implemented which specifies the frequency of cleaning, the persons responsible, the method of cleaning, the amount and type of chemical to be used and precautions to be taken (i.e. protective clothing).

What are the 2 types of housekeeping?
Institutional housekeeping is maintenance that is done in commercial lodging buildings such hotels, resorts, and inns. Domestic housekeeping is maintenance that is done in a residential buildings or homes, including bedrooms, kitchen, dining, receiving area, grounds and the surrounding areas of the house.

How many square feet can be cleaned in an hour?
The industry standard on general office cleaning (usually 3 – 5 days a week, including vacuuming, moping, bathrooms, kitchens, mostly carpet in the building etc.) usually takes ONE person ONE hour to clean 3000 – 4000 square feet.
How many square feet can a housekeeper clean?
According to Mary Starkey’s text book Setting Household Standards, a good rule is that it takes four hours to clean 2,000 square feet for average standards if performed weekly. (500 sq. ft. / hour) This does not include spring cleaning or daily service requests.

How do I figure out how many housekeepers I need?
- Executive housekeeper: 1 for a 300 room property.
- Assistant housekeepers: 2 (1 per morning and evening shift)
- Floor supervisors: 1 per 60 rooms for the morning shift; 1 for the evening shift; 1 for the night shift.
- Public area supervisors: 1 for each shift.
- Linen/uniform room supervisors: 1.
How do you calculate cleaning time?
Cleaning time can be calculated as the amount of square footage to be cleaned divided by the production rate multiplied by the time in minutes.
